Where is it

On Cannery Row with its shops, galleries, wine and restaurants. Explore the coastal trail by bike or on foot, or wander down to historic Fisherman’s Wharf and the aquarium, about 10 minutes away. It's a short drive to Carmel, Big Sur and a wealth of golf courses.

Hotel information

379 nautically-styled rooms. All with ceiling fan, flat-screen HDTV, pay-per-view films, WiFi*, mini-fridge, tea/coffee-making facilities, safe, hairdryer, iron and ironing board. Portola Rooms are located throughout the hotel and have 1 king-size bed or 2 double beds, sleeping maximum 2 adults and 2 children.

The Club Room (buffet breakfast and brunch), Jack's Monterey restaurant & lobby bar (regional cuisine, open for lunch and dinner), Peter B's Brewpub (craft brewery and pub food, open for lunch and dinner), Peet’s Coffee (café). Outdoor pool and Jacuzzi. Spa on the Plaza* (full salon, relaxing lounge, steam room, sauna and 10 treatment rooms). Fitness centre. Bicycle rentals*. Kids self-guided treasure hunt around hotel. Self-parking $22, valet parking $27, plus tax per night (payable locally, subject to change).
